Man found unresponsive after kitchen fall in Glendale, Glendale KY


A 62-year-old man was found unresponsive after falling in his kitchen near Star Mills Road in Glendale. He had normal breathing and began to become alert before emergency services arrived. The man had been drinking all day and had a possible stroke a few weeks earlier.
